BIOPARC Valencia is open 365 days a year, providing consistent access to its wildlife habitats regardless of holidays.

The park opens every morning at 10 AM. While the opening time is fixed, closing times fluctuate throughout the year based on available daylight hours. Typically, the park closes at 6 PM during the winter months, with extended hours until 8 PM or 9 PM during the peak summer season.

It is important to note that the ticket office closes 30 minutes before the park's doors shut, and animal enclosures may begin closing shortly before the official park exit time.

Recommended Duration

To fully experience the four primary habitats and attend at least one educational demonstration, visitors should set aside a minimum of 4 to 5 hours.

Those who wish to take a more leisurely pace, photograph the wildlife, or dine at the Samburu restaurant overlooking the savannah often spend a full day (approximately 7 hours) in the park.

Best Time to Visit

For the quietest experience, arriving at 10 AM on a weekday is highly recommended. This allows you to explore the Madagascar and Equatorial Forest zones before the midday peak.

If you are visiting during the summer, the late afternoon is also an excellent time, as temperatures begin to drop and many animals become more active.

Things to Know Before Visiting BIOPARC Valencia

Tickets are sold for specific time slots, so you must arrive during your assigned entry window to guarantee access.

Outside food and drinks are not permitted inside the park, with the exception of water in non-glass containers.

The park has a strict no-re-entry policy, meaning your ticket becomes invalid once you exit the grounds.

Flash photography is prohibited at all times to avoid startling the animals and disrupting their natural behaviors.

BIOPARC Valencia is a smoke-free environment, and smoking is only allowed in a single designated area near the entrance.

Pets are not allowed to enter the park, though certified guide dogs with original documentation are permitted.

You should arrive at the amphitheater at least 15 minutes early for the "Cycle of Life" exhibition, as seating is limited and fills up quickly.

Professional photography or video recording for commercial use requires prior written authorization from the park administration.

Visitors must remain fully clothed, including shirts and footwear, throughout the duration of their visit to the park.

Some animal species may not be visible during the final hour of operation as they begin moving to their indoor enclosures for the night.

Dining at BIOPARC Valencia is centered around the Samburu Restaurant, a large self-service facility that offers panoramic views of the African Savannah.

Guests can dine while observing giraffes, rhinos, and zebras, providing a unique backdrop for a meal. The menu features a variety of Mediterranean and international options, including salads, pasta, grilled meats, and desserts, with specific menus available for children and those with common dietary requirements, such as gluten-free options.

For a more casual or quick break, the park features several kiosks and smaller snack bars, such as the Ndoki Cafe. These outlets provide light refreshments, sandwiches, coffee, and ice cream, with outdoor seating areas that allow visitors to stay immersed in the park's atmosphere.

To maintain the safety and nutritional health of the animals, guests are asked to use the designated picnic areas if they choose to bring their own food, as eating is not permitted inside the animal viewing enclosures.

BIOPARC Valencia - Nearby Attractions

Cabecera Park: This expansive riverside green space directly borders the BIOPARC and features walking and biking paths, children's playgrounds, and a lake with boat rentals.

Jardín del Turia: Located just a short distance from the entrance, this 9-kilometer park occupies a former riverbed and winds through the city center, connecting major cultural landmarks.

Ciudad de las Artes y las Ciencias: Situated at the opposite end of the Turia Garden, this futuristic complex includes a science museum, an IMAX cinema, and an opera house.

Oceanogràfic València: Part of the City of Arts and Sciences, this massive aquarium is home to over 500 marine species and features one of the largest dolphinariums in the world.

La Lonja de la Seda de Valencia: Accessible via a short bus or metro ride toward the city center, this UNESCO World Heritage site is a masterpiece of late Gothic architecture.

FAQs about Visiting BIOPARC Valencia

Is it necessary to buy tickets in advance for BIOPARC Valencia?

While you can purchase tickets at the entrance, booking online is highly recommended to secure your preferred entry time and access faster entry lanes.

Are tickets valid for the entire day?

Entry is based on a specific time slot, but once inside, you are welcome to explore the park until the official closing time.

What is included in a standard entry ticket?

A general ticket provides complete access to all four animal habitats and the live educational demonstrations in the amphitheater.

Can I leave the park for lunch and come back?

The park operates a strict no-re-entry policy, meaning you cannot return once you have passed through the exit gates.

Is BIOPARC Valencia open on public holidays?

The park is open 365 days a year, though closing hours may be adjusted based on the specific time of year and sunset.

What is the best time of day to see the animals?

Arriving right at 10 AM or visiting in the late afternoon often provides the best viewing opportunities as many species are more active during cooler hours.

How long does a typical visit take?

Most visitors spend between 4 and 5 hours exploring the habitats, though you may stay longer if you dine at the on-site restaurant.

Can I bring my own food into the park?

Outside food and snacks are not permitted inside the grounds, although guests may bring water in non-glass containers.

Are there lockers available for heavy bags or luggage?

The park provides a paid automated locker service where visitors can securely store personal items for the duration of their visit.

Is the park accessible for guests using wheelchairs?

BIOPARC is fully accessible with wide, paved paths and ramps, and a limited number of manual wheelchairs are available for free at the entrance.

Can I bring my dog to the park?

Pets are not allowed inside BIOPARC, with the exception of certified service and guide dogs that meet specific accreditation requirements.

Are strollers available to rent for young children?

Families can rent strollers at the park entrance, and several designated stroller parking areas are located near the main habitat zones.

What happens if it rains during my visit?

The park remains open during rain, and as most of the experience is outdoors, ticket refunds are not typically issued due to weather conditions.

How do I get to BIOPARC from the city center?

You can take Metro lines 3, 5, or 9 to Nou d’Octubre station or use EMT bus line 95, which stops directly near the park.
